The playfully made Leaps & Bounds 2-in-1 Flyer Dog Toy makes fetching, tugging and leaping a breeze. Your pup will love watching this flyer sail through the sky-as long as it lands straight into their mouth! This flyer toy is perfect for taking fetch time up a notch.

FOR PET USE ONLY. NOT A CHILD S TOY. Flyer is for fetch play only. Not intended for heavy chewing. Small parts and small balls can present a choking hazard or gastrointestinal blockage risk. Always supervise pet closely during play to prevent accidental swallowing of small parts. Never aim the flyer at the face or body of pets or others. Inspect regularly. Replace if any part becomes damaged. To prevent ingestion of excessive amounts of water, closely monitor your pet in the water and limit the duration of water play. Seek veterinary care immediately if your pet exhibits any unusual behavior after water play.
